The US Internet news portal, Breitbart news is offering a $50,000 reward to  anyone who can provide the videotape of a 2003 dinner honoring a radical  Palestinian American academic attended by then Illinois state senator Barack  Obama.

Obama has acknowledged  a close, long-term friendship between his family and the Khalidi family. Khalidi  and his wife Mona, who served as the editor of the PLO’s English news service in  Beirut from 1976-1982, hosted a fundraiser for Obama’s failed Congressional  campaign in 2000.
According to the Times report, at the 2003 dinner,  Khalidi told his Palestinian American guests to support Obama’s 2004 bid for the  US Senate. According to the report Khalidi said, “You will not have a better  senator under any circumstances.”
During Obama’s tenure as a director on  the board of the Woods Fund of Chicago, the charitable group donated $75,000 to  Khalidi’s Arab American Action Network.
The Times article notes the  virulently anti-Israel discussion that took place at the 2003 Khalidi dinner.  Among other things, a Palestinian read a poem accusing Israel’s government of  terrorism and sharply criticizing US support for Israel. The speaker reportedly  threatened Israel saying that if Palestinian interests are not secured, “then  you [Israel] will never see a day of peace.”
